Permits Issued for 5937 Osage Avenue in Cobbs Creek, West Philadelphia

Permits have been issued for the construction of a three-story two-family rowhouse at 5937 Osage Avenue in Cobbs Creek, West Philadelphia. The new building will rise from a vacant lot on the north side of the block between South 59th Street and South 60th Street. Designed by the 24/7 Design Group, the structure will span 1,720 square feet and will feature a rear terrace and a roof deck. Permits list D and V Contractors as the contractor.

Construction Tops Out at 2510 Sepviva Street in Olde Richmond, Kensington

A recent site visit by Philadelphia YIMBY has noted that construction has topped out at a four-story single-family rowhouse underway at 2510 Sepviva Street in Olde Richmond, Kensington. The new building replaces a single-story garage that stood on the northwest side of the block between East Cumberland Street and East Firth Street. Designed by Plato Marinakos, Jr. of Plato Studio, the building will span 2,568 square feet and will include a roof deck. Permits list Lawrence General Contractors as the contractor.

Cladding Nearly Finished at Jefferson Specialty Care Pavilion in Market East, Center City

A recent site visit by Philly YIMBY has captured the latest construction progress at the dazzling, blue-glass-walled Jefferson Specialty Care Pavilion rising at 1101 Chestnut Street in Market EastCenter City. The building, rises 364 feet and 23 stories (19 stories if excluding mechanical floors) and comprises the bulk of East Market Phase 3, the final component of the mixed-use, multi-block East Market development. The $762 million medical facility, the single largest real estate investment in nearly 200-year history of Jefferson Health, will span around 462,000 square feet and feature over 300 examination rooms, as well as 58 infusion chairs, ten operating rooms, six endoscopy rooms, imaging and lab services, a pharmacy, and more. The development team consists of Ennead Architects and Stantec as designers, Jefferson Health and National Real Estate Development as developers, and a joint venture of LF Driscoll and Hunter Roberts Construction Group as contractors.

Six Multi-Family Buildings Proposed at 2223 Through 2239 North 33rd Street in Strawberry Mansion, North Philadelphia

Six three-story multi-family buildings have been proposed at 2223, 2227, 2229, 2233, 2237, and 2239 North 33rd Street in Strawberry Mansion, North Philadelphia, across from Fairmount Park. Designed by 24 Seven Design Group LLC, the four buildings at 2223 through 2233 North 33rd Street will each feature five apartments each, and the structures at 2237 and 2239 North 33rd Street will each come with four units, giving a total new unit count of 28. Each of the permits lists Catalyst Builders LLC as the contractor, and, although the structures appear of to slightly vary in square footage (spanning from 3,072 to 5,000 square feet), construction costs for each one is specified at $300,000.
